About Wyndcliff Wood
You're looking at a mix of broadleaf and conifer woodland with a network of trails that range from gentle ambles to proper leg-work. The main draw is the viewpoint that overlooks the Wye Valley - it's the kind of spot where you understand why people get sentimental about English countryside. The walk itself takes between one and two hours depending on which route you choose and how often you stop to catch your breath.

Families with kids aged eight upwards will manage it fine - younger ones might need carrying on the steeper bits.
Go early if you can. Weekday mornings mean you'll have the place mostly to yourself, which changes the whole experience. The wood's best after rain when everything smells properly alive. Bring decent boots - the paths get boggy and uneven in places. It's not a destination on its own, but as part of a Forest of Dean or Wye Valley holiday, it's well worth the detour.
